Output 80d5d90b8b26e60bd33c5ae2d14b68e526ec70fb052037271cb8fda1194482cc:1

value
38569
script pubkey
OP_0 OP_PUSHBYTES_20 3209de7041ad90348459674e5ad868dece5df97c
address
tb1qxgyauuzp4kgrfpzeva894krgmm89m7tupmvf86
transaction
80d5d90b8b26e60bd33c5ae2d14b68e526ec70fb052037271cb8fda1194482cc